Transaction ff7a2d08b6cb39cf748c80dcca59338d6ba91b43468029ad2d80568a4792c1fa

1 Input
1 Outputs
  • ff7a2d08b6cb39cf748c80dcca59338d6ba91b43468029ad2d80568a4792c1fa:0
  • value  256654
    address  3NPQze8dB2bBYWR6h7uDdspe7ea4xXGKGT